Storm Shutter Replacement in Overland Park, KS
Storm shutter replacement services involve upgrading or installing new storm shutters to protect windows and doors during severe weather events.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ing worn or damaged shutters, upgrading to more durable materials, or installing shutters on new properties. Homeowners typically want to understand the different types of storm shutters available, such as roll-down, accordion, or storm panels, as well as the benefits of each. Additionally, property owners often seek information about the installation process, compatibility with existing windows, and how the new shutters can enhance property protection and curb appeal.
Before requesting storm shutter replacement, property owners should consider the size and type of windows they want to shield, along with any local building codes or regulations that may influence the project. It’s also helpful to know the material options, such as aluminum or polycarbonate, and their respective advantages. Clarifying the scope of work, including whether existing shutters need removal or if new mounting hardware is required, can ensure a smooth replacement process. Understanding these details helps homeowners make informed decisions about their storm protection solutions.

Storm Shutter Replacement Questions
What are storm shutters used for? Storm shutters provide protection for windows and doors during severe weather events, helping to prevent damage from wind, debris, and hail.
When should storm shutters be replaced? Replacement is recommended when shutters are damaged, warped, or no longer secure properly, ensuring continued protection during storms.
What types of storm shutters are available? Common types include roll-down, storm panels, and bahama shutters, each offering different levels of protection and ease of use.
How can I tell if my storm shutters need replacement? Signs include difficulty operating, visible damage, or compromised locking mechanisms, indicating they may no longer provide effective protection.
